Review summary

This was a very good cruise.  It was relaxing.  The ship was comfortable and clean.  The price was right.  Great itinerary.  Cruising out of New Orleans was GREAT.  You could see a lot of the Lower Mississippi River. (104 miles to the Gulf of Mexico)

Cabin / Stateroom

5 out of 5
Out of 20 something cruises, this was the largest bathroom I've ever seen, Large shower, private commode closet. Also, this was the most storage we ever had on any cruise. There were areas we didn't put anything in. Everything was put away in a place. Usually everything is so piled up, you could hardly get to it. GREAT room.

Ship tip

We've been on very large ships. This was about medium to small size. The ship was spacious enough. More personable, very relaxing, didn't have to rush to get anywhere. Very good Ship.
